Configure object types

Maintain the type lists users pick from when they create or edit a Performance Indicator, Journey, Capability, Opportunity, or Process. All five areas use the same screen, so the steps below apply to each.

Prerequisites

  • The matching repository permission for each area — Manage Performance Indicator Configuration, Manage Journey Configuration, Manage Capability Configuration, or Manage Opportunity Configuration. Process Types instead requires Manage Repository Configuration. See Assigning Security Roles.

Steps

  1. In the Repository area, select the object type to configure:

    AreaType lists
    Performance IndicatorsPerformance Indicator Types
    JourneysJourney Types
    CapabilitiesCapability Types
    OpportunitiesOpportunity Types and, on a second tab, Opportunity Instance Types
    ProcessesProcess Types
  2. Click Add type to add a top-level type, or Add subtype on a row to nest a child type. Type names can be up to 255 characters and must be unique.

  3. Save the row. Use a row's Edit and delete actions to maintain existing types, and Expand all to open the whole hierarchy.

Process Types ships with a standard hierarchy — Management, Core, and Support processes with their child types — and a read-only Standard type that every process gets by default and that you can't rename or delete. Set a process's type on the process's Settings tab.
